What it does

Archvision is an AI-driven architectural workflow that empowers users to visualize their dream spaces without compromise. It seamlessly turns rough ideas into "Geometry-Aware" 2D concepts and technical artifacts, rapidly powering immersive 3D Gaussian Splat environments in mere minutes. Users can instantly explore these high-fidelity 3D renders directly on our web interface or export them to a professional 3D editor of their choice. For a construction or prop-tech startup, Archvision acts as the ultimate rapid-prototyping engine. It completely solves the common real estate problem where a client tours a property and says, "I love the kitchen, but I hate the layout of the rest of the house." Instead of losing that client, a startup can use Archvision on the spot to instantly re-visualize the space, tailored perfectly to the buyer's exact desires, creating a deep resonance and securing the contract.Throughout the conversation, Archvision intelligently extracts and structures critical project data, such as spatial requirements, structural constraints, MEP preferences, zoning assumptions, and material selections. Archvision transforms casual client dialogue into a comprehensive technical specification report. Clients and stakeholders can provide additional inputs directly through chat, allowing Archvision to continuously refine and formalize the project into permit-ready, engineering-informed documentation in real time.

How we built it

We architected a robust technical pipeline connecting a Large Language Model (LLM) with an open-source Vision-Language Model (VLM). This system takes the user's creative desires and translates them into precise image instructions optimized for a 3D real-time environment. By bridging these advanced AI models, we established a seamless flow from natural language ideation directly into spatial geometry.

Challenges we ran into

As a team of freshman college kids, we had boundless passion but quickly discovered the realities of collaborative software development. Our biggest hurdle was a chaotic Git merge conflict. Late into the build, we pushed what we thought were incorrect changes that completely broke our local environments. Panic set in, and we spent stressful hours rolling back versions and hunting for non-existent bugs. In reality, nothing significant was wrong with the code; it was just a simple miscommunication about our local setups. It was a humbling moment that taught us the critical importance of: Deeply understanding our tech stack. Establishing a strict version-control workflow. Having the patience to ensure everyone on the team is on the same page before hitting "push."
